Computational results of cortical currents during tDCS using a 1 mm3 resolution patient-specific head model. The top two rows show sample segmentation masks. First: gray matter, skull, white matter. Juxtaposed images of the FE model (rendered from the segmentation masks) and 3D model (rendered from patient’s MRI scans using MRIcro) are also shown. All the images in the second row are plotted with the same view. Montage A: Right Shoulder; Montage B: Right Mastoid; Montage C: Right Orbitofrontal; Montage D: Mirror Montage A. All false color maps were generated between 0 and 0.36 V/m; the peak cortical electric field (EF) magnitude for Montage A. Surface magnitude plots of EF were generated with different views. A.2, B.2, C.2, D.2 show current flow in the lesional and peri-lesional areas. The dashed region is expanded in A.3, B.3, C.3, D.3 and scaled between 0 and 0.18 V/m (half of the peak electric field for Montage A) to highlight current flow in the posterior peri-lesional areas.
